Compared to freestanding ovens, built-in units offer a number of benefits, including increased functionality and resale value. However, these ovens may be more expensive to purchase and install, and might require additional cabinetry or modifications to fit the kitchen layout. They may also be less accessible for certain users, particularly if they are installed at eye level or higher.

Before purchasing a single built in oven You should measure the width, height and depth of the cabinet cutout to ensure a appropriate fit. You should also keep in mind that the door to the oven will extend past the cabinet by several inches, so you'll need to leave enough space to open and close it. It is also important to follow the manufacturer's instructions for installation and speak with an here expert for assistance.

The cost of a built-in oven is contingent on the model and size you choose as well as if you're replacing an old unit. Installation costs are minimal for replacing an oven that's the same size. If you're installing a brand new wall oven that's larger size, you'll probably need to pay for upgrades to the construction like a new outlet or gas line.

You'll also need to consider the cost of labor if you hire a professional for appliance installation. This will vary based on the extent of your job, so it's recommended to talk with a local contractor before making an ultimate decision.
